This is the second course in a three-course sequence preparing students to do creative and rigorous journalism in a highly competitive and complex media ecosystem. Increased attention will be paid to using design strategies to identify community needs and problem solve audience engagement, considering such factors as context for consumption and multi-channel participation. Brainstorming, research and other design strategies will be used to imagine new ways of reporting and expressing the news. In addition to growing expectations for depth of reporting, increased emphasis will be on creative presentation of work, and telling stories visually as well as through writing. The class is project-based and collaborative. A designer and a data reporter are embedded in the class. Other experts will be brought in based on student need. To register, students must have already taken News, Narrative & Design I and earned a minimum grade of "B" .
